The Anker SOLIX F3800 Plus Portable Power Station is a robust choice for those seeking a reliable power source during outages or for RV and emergency uses. With a massive capacity of 3,840Wh, it’s capable of providing your family with a day’s worth of power. For extended needs, you can expand its capacity significantly with additional batteries up to 26.9kWh or even more by bundling another unit. This flexibility is a key strength, making it suitable for longer-term outages or off-grid living.

The power station’s dual-voltage 120V/240V capability and 6,000W AC output mean you can power larger household appliances, like dryers, without restriction. Even more power can be harnessed by pairing it with another SOLIX F3800 Plus for a 12,000W output. The included 400W solar panels and compatibility with gas generators provide versatile recharging options, ensuring you stay powered in various situations.

Its portability is somewhat limited due to its considerable dimensions and weight of 146.4 pounds, which may not make it the easiest to move around. It’s more suited for stationary use rather than frequent mobility. The intelligent remote control via the Anker app is a great added feature. It allows you to manage power usage efficiently through Wi-Fi or Bluetooth, maximizing savings. The 5-year warranty and a promise of a 10-year lifespan with EV-class LFP batteries highlight its durability. Direct compatibility with EVs and RVs via specific ports adds to its versatility.

While it's not the most portable option due to its size and weight, the Anker SOLIX F3800 Plus excels in capacity, output power, and versatility, making it an excellent solution for those who require substantial, reliable power for home or on-the-road scenarios.

The Anker SOLIX C1000 Portable Power Station stands out as a robust choice for power needs during emergencies, camping, or home use. With a hefty 1056Wh LFP battery, it offers extensive capacity suitable for long-duration use and can power multiple devices simultaneously through its 11 ports. This includes 6 AC outlets, which is more than sufficient for most appliances. Its noteworthy SurgePad technology boosts output power to 2400W, accommodating 99% of common appliances, making it a versatile tool.

Portability is decent given its function, although at 27.6 pounds, it's not the lightest option available, which might be a consideration if you're frequently on the move. However, the included solar panel and its adaptability with 4 angle settings maximize sunlight absorption, boasting 1.5X higher conversion efficiency compared to similar models. This is beneficial for outdoor enthusiasts looking to harness solar power efficiently.

UltraFast recharging is a remarkable feature, enabling 80% charge in just 43 minutes when using AC input, controlled via a smartphone app. This quick recharge time minimizes downtime, enhancing convenience for impromptu adventures or emergencies. The battery longevity is another strong point, designed for up to 3,000 cycles, ensuring reliability over ten years. Additionally, its IP67 weatherproof rating means it's built to withstand harsh conditions including rain and dust, which is ideal for outdoor activities.

One downside might be the reliance on a smartphone app for some functionalities, potentially limiting usability for those less tech-savvy. Furthermore, the weight could be a challenge for certain users. Nonetheless, the product's high capacity, versatile power options, and efficient solar capabilities make it a compelling option for those who require portable yet powerful energy solutions.

The Anker Prime Power Bank is a powerful, portable charger with a large 26,250mAh capacity that fits well for users needing to recharge laptops and smartphones on the go. It stands out with its 300W total output spread across three ports (two USB-C and one USB-A), which means it can fast-charge high-demand devices such as MacBook Pros and the latest iPhones efficiently. Thanks to its 140W max fast charging capability, it can top up a MacBook Pro or iPhone to half capacity in about half an hour, which is ideal for busy users who need quick power boosts.

One of its best features is the rapid recharge speed of the power bank itself, supported by 250W input via two USB-C ports; this helps reduce downtime when you’re constantly using your devices. The power bank’s TSA approval at 99.75Wh lets you carry it on flights without hassle, a big plus for travelers. It also sports a smart digital display and app control for monitoring and adjusting charging output, adding convenience for tech-savvy users.

The unit weighs 1.33 pounds and measures over 6 inches long, so it’s not the smallest or lightest for everyday pocket carry. The 3-port setup is versatile, but more USB-A ports might benefit users with older devices. Also, the base charger needed for recharging is sold separately, which is something to keep in mind. This power bank is well suited for professionals and travelers who need reliable, fast charging for multiple devices, especially laptops and smartphones, though it is bulkier than smaller options if ultra-light portability is prioritized.

Buying Guide for the Best Anker Power Banks

When choosing an Anker power bank, it's important to consider your specific needs and how you plan to use the device. Power banks come in various sizes, capacities, and with different features, so understanding these key specifications will help you make an informed decision. Here are the main factors to consider when selecting the best Anker power bank for you.
Capacity (mAh)Capacity, measured in milliampere-hours (mAh), indicates how much charge the power bank can store. This is crucial because it determines how many times you can charge your devices. Smaller capacities (5,000-10,000 mAh) are suitable for occasional use and can charge a smartphone once or twice. Medium capacities (10,000-20,000 mAh) are ideal for daily use and can charge a smartphone multiple times or a tablet once. Larger capacities (20,000 mAh and above) are best for heavy users or for charging multiple devices over several days. Choose a capacity based on how often you need to charge your devices and how many devices you need to charge.
PortabilityPortability refers to the size and weight of the power bank. This is important if you plan to carry the power bank with you frequently. Smaller, lighter power banks are easier to carry in a pocket or small bag, making them ideal for everyday use or travel. Larger power banks, while offering more capacity, can be bulkier and heavier, which might be less convenient for on-the-go use. Consider how and where you will be using the power bank to determine the right balance between capacity and portability.
Number of PortsThe number of ports on a power bank determines how many devices you can charge simultaneously. This is important if you have multiple devices that need charging at the same time. Power banks with one or two ports are sufficient for most users, while those with three or more ports are useful for charging multiple devices, such as smartphones, tablets, and other gadgets, at once. Think about how many devices you typically need to charge and choose a power bank with an appropriate number of ports.
Output Power (W)Output power, measured in watts (W), indicates how quickly the power bank can charge your devices. Higher output power means faster charging times. Standard power banks offer 5-10W output, which is suitable for most smartphones. For faster charging, look for power banks with 18W or higher output, which can charge devices like tablets and some smartphones more quickly. If you have devices that support fast charging, choosing a power bank with higher output power will be beneficial.
Input Charging SpeedInput charging speed refers to how quickly the power bank itself can be recharged. This is important if you need to recharge the power bank frequently. Faster input charging speeds mean less downtime between uses. Standard input speeds are around 5-10W, while faster options can be 18W or higher. If you use your power bank often and need it to be ready quickly, look for one with a higher input charging speed.
Additional FeaturesAdditional features can enhance the usability and convenience of a power bank. Some power banks come with built-in cables, LED indicators, wireless charging capabilities, or even solar panels. These features can be useful depending on your specific needs. For example, built-in cables reduce the need to carry extra cables, LED indicators help you monitor the charge level, and wireless charging can be convenient for compatible devices. Consider which additional features would be most beneficial for your use case.
